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48235650 05330536 4912
35562 09966 833891
35562 09966 833891
65268 5580 782301 921957173 057061568
All about undefined
Interested in learning more?
35562 09966 833891
65268 5580 782301 921957173 057061568
See more
492 5038
26820 5742 5343283
See more
57 40336 78
40999 701876113 913 173848
See more